Manuel Barreto’s appeal was in the same vein as last time, to young players and footballers who will be donning red and white for the first time. Play against the Peruvian team Russia, Wednesday, November 12th in St. Petersburg and against it Chile, Tuesday, November 18th In Sochi.
- archer: Pedro Gallese (no club), Diego Henriques (Sporting Cristal), Diego Romero (Banfield, Argentina)
- defense: Miguel Araujo (Sporting Cristal), Luis Abram (Sporting Cristal), Fabio Gruber (Nuremberg, Germany), Renzo Garces (Alianza Lima), Cesar Inga (Universitario), Matias Laso (Melgar), Cristian Carvajal (Sportboyz), Marcos López (Copenhagen, Denmark).
- midfielder: Jesús Pretel (Sporting Cristal), Eric Noriega (Gremio of Brazil), Jesus Castillo (Universitario), Martín Tabara (Sporting Cristal), Jairo Concha (Universitario), Piero Cali (Alianza Lima), Piero Couspe (Sydney FC of Australia), Max Lauren Castro (Sporting Cristal) Carlos Cabello (ADT).
- forward: Alex Barrera (University), Yodi Reyna (Rodina Moscow, Russia), Adrian Ugarisa (Kiryat Shmona, Israel), Kevin Quevedo (Alianza Lima), Kenji Cabrera (Vancouver Whitecaps, Canada), Brian Reyna (Belgrano, Argentina), João Grimaldo (Riga FC, Latvia), Johnny Vidales (Melgar).
- sparring: Cesar Bautista (goalkeeper of Sporting Cristal), Filip Eisele (defender of Eintracht Frankfurt of Germany), Rafael Guzman (defense of Universitario), Francesco Andreali (midfielder of Como 1907 of Italy), Jair Moretti (attacker of Sporting Cristal).
